K190532 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the TruDi NAV Wire. This device is classified as a Ear, Nose, And Throat Stereotaxic Instrument (Class II - Special Controls, product code PGW).

Submitted by Acclarent, Inc. (Irvin,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on May 3, 2019, 60 days after receiving the submission on March 4, 2019.

This device falls under the Ear, Nose, Throat FDA review panel. Regulated under 21 CFR 882.4560. Intended As An Aid For Precisely Locating A Surgical Instrument Within Anatomical Structures In Either Open Or Percutaneous Procedures For Any Medical Condition In Which A Reference To A Rigid Anatomical Structure In The Field Of Ent Surgery Can Be Identified Relative To A Ct- Or Mr-based Model Or Digitized Landmarks Of The Anatomy..
